Default Reducing drone

I am looking at ways to reduce drone, mod list below:
  1. Cam
  2. Headers (race pipe)
  3. Blower
  4. Heads
  5. Borla Stingers
Has anyone added resonators right after the x-pipe on both banks? Did it help?


Looking at two of these:
Amazon Amazon


The drone is terrible 52-63 mph

Pretty sure the Borla's are the problem. You appear to have several good performance mods. Never heard of anyone adding the resonators but it might work. The stingers have very minimal mufflers (unless you have the newer Type II stingers) and combined with the cam, headers and blower, it's gonna be letting you know it's there. The rumble from the Stingers are nice, but the drone can be tough. I have much the same issue with my Flowmasters on a high HP motor but I love the sound. Fortunately for me, most of my driving is streets (under 50mph) or highway (at or slightly above 70mph). Maybe someone else can chime in and answer the resonator question. Alternative might be a Corsa or a stock Titanium Z catback. Have heard good things with Magnaflow too.

When the C5 Corvette first came out, we released aggressive sounding systems for it, but they did drone... They were very popular systems, however, we recognized the fact that a lot of our customers wanted an aggressive sounding system that did NOT drone. That said, in 2011, we went back and designed new systems for the C5 using newer technology to eliminate the drone. This newer technology is what we now use in all of our exhaust systems.

If you take a look at what we offer for the C5 on our website, you will see "S-Type Classic" systems, an "S-Type II" system, & an "ATAK" system... https://www.borla.com/chevy-corvette...haust-systems/

S-Type Classic = Older Systems
S-Type II = Newer System (NO drone)
ATAK = Newer System (NO drone)

We still sell the "S-Type Classic" systems because they are still popular, but we always recommend the "S-Type II" & "ATAK" systems to those that do NOT want drone.

Not sure this will be helpful since the part is discontinued, but Borla made a muffled/resonated x-pipe that went along with their old XR-1 system: https://www.borla.com/products/c5_co...rt__60061.html
I picked up a used one when I was getting a little too much drone from my Magnaflow exhaust. It knocked out the drone significantly, not perfect, but about an 80% reduction, which made the car much more enjoyable. As other posters have mentioned, the only 100% solution is to get different mufflers.
